[英]Storing files on simulator vs actual iOS device
目前,我正在使用以下代碼在模擬器上本地存儲一些mp3文件,以獲取路徑。
manager = [NSFileManager defaultManager];
NSArray* paths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ES);
filePath = [paths objectAtIndex:0];
這種存儲方法在模擬器上可以正常工作,但是當我在調試器中檢查實際路徑時,它最終成為了我的Macbook上模擬器用來存儲其數據的路徑。 有人知道該代碼是否也可以在實際設備上運行嗎? 是否會生成特定於目標設備的其他路徑? 謝謝。
當然,此代碼應該沒問題, NSFileManager
將為您管理此操作,在iPhone設備上,它將解析為您的應用程序沙箱。 因此,這將是一條不同的絕對路徑,但這與您無關。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.